Haryana government announces state sports fund
Chandigarh, Nov 21 (IANS) In order to promote sports and sportspersons in the state, the Haryana government Saturday announced the setting up of a state sports fund.
Chief Minister Bhupinder Singh Hooda said his government is committed to promote sporting culture in the state and also plans to open a sports academy and a sports university in the state.
Hooda said the cash awards to medal winners at National Games had been enhanced to Rs.3 lakh (gold), Rs.2 lakh (silver) and Rs.1 lakh (bronze) from Rs.51,000, Rs.31,000 and Rs.11,000 earlier.
Hooda was speaking at the opening ceremony of the 23rd Haryana State Games organised at the campus of Maharshi Dayanand University (MDU) in Rohtak.
The four-day games are being organised by the Haryana Olympic Association. Nearly 6,000 players from all over Haryana are participating in 28 sporting events.
